The story

The thread kicked off with a claim that Eiichiro Oda himself may be breaking the principle he set for One Piece’s Zoro — that to become the world’s greatest swordsman, he’ll only fight other swordsmen — through recent developments involving Luffy (Nika).

On 5ch, the discussion didn’t stop at that question and expanded into a full-blown “name a manga better than One Piece” debate, with posters throwing out titles like Chainsaw Man, Demon Slayer, and Jujutsu Kaisen. Interpretations of Zoro’s rule were also split, with some pushing back that there’s nothing wrong with him fighting non-swordsmen at all.

Background and Key Points of the Debate

Within the story, Zoro has repeatedly been shown pursuing the dream of becoming the world’s greatest swordsman, a goal that requires defeating the world’s strongest swordsman (Mihawk). The claim at the center of this thread stems from readers’ sense that, in recent years, Luffy (Nika) has increasingly clashed with powerful enemies who aren’t swordsmen, making Zoro’s “only fight swordsmen” principle feel diluted by comparison. That said, it’s worth noting that Eiichiro Oda himself has never explicitly stated in the manga or in official materials that “Zoro will only fight swordsmen” — some posters in the thread pushed back, saying they don’t recall Oda ever setting such a rule — so the premise itself leaves room for interpretation. The comparisons drawn to Demon Slayer, Jujutsu Kaisen, and Chainsaw Man are likewise subjective, personal-taste judgments rather than being based on objective measures like circulation figures or popularity rankings.
